The Yoakum City Jail despite the name is not a jail. The Yoakum City Jail is just a holding pen for people who have been arrested in the Yoakum limits.
Unfortunately, with the holding pen in the Yoakum City Jail is quite small. So, offenders will only be in this small holding pen for hours, if that. Most of the offenders that have been arrested in the Yoakum limits will be brought directly to the Dewitt County Detention Center and skip going down to the Yoakum City Jail all together.
Keep in mind that the Yoakum Police Department will also manage this smallholding pen as well.

How to Find Someone in Yoakum City Jail
There is no way in with the Yoakum Police Department where you can locate an inmate. There will be no inmates that are in the Yoakum City Jail.
Ultimately, all inmates will ALWAYS be brought down to the Dewitt County Detention Center. If you would like to contact them to find out if the offender you are looking for is in their facility, you can at 361-293-6321.
When contacting the Dewitt County Detention Center, please tell them you suspect that the Yoakum Police Department was the arresting agency along with the offender first and last name.

Sending Money
The Yoakum City Jail is rarely ever used. The offender may be in a cell for just under an hour, if that. The offender will NOT have any need for cash during their time in the holding pen. You will want to wait to send cash when they get over to the Dewitt County Detention Center.
Phone calls
The offender will not be permitted to make any phone calls until they are officially booked into the Dewitt County Detention Center. As previously stated, the Yoakum Police Department will bring the offender typically to that facility as it has more manpower.
Visitation
The Yoakum City Jail is rarely used. There is NO visitation whatsoever in the Yoakum City Jail. You will want to wait until the offender gets transferred, booked, and processed into the Dewitt County Detention Center before you will be permitted to visit with them.
